Abstract | These two volumes comprise the official proceedings of the second White House Conference on Aging, held November 28-December 2, 1971. Volume I includes an overview of the Conference plan--its background, concepts, organization, and programming. It presents the contributions made by speakers at the General Sessions and Conference Delegate luncheons. Volume II is devoted to reports of the work of the 14 Subject Area Sections and the 17 Special Concerns Sessions, which resulted in the formulation of the Conference recommendations. These recommendations concern the following: Education; Employment and Retirement; Physical and Mental Health; Housing; Income; Nutrition; Retirement Roles and Activities; Spiritual Well-Being; Transportation; Facilities, Programs, and Services; Government and Nongovernment Organization; Planning; Research and Demonstration; Training; Health Care Strategies; Disability and Rehabilitation; The Rural and the Poor Elderly; The Elderly Among the Minorities; Protective and Social Support; and Roles for Old and Young.
